The latest blog offering tips is called To Be productive at http://2bproductive.blogspot.com.
This blog was started by Shirley Fine Lee, of Lewisville and author of R.A!R.A! A Meeting Wizard's Approach, along with three other DFW area consultants who offer coaching and training in various areas. Many of the blog contributors have written books and are recognized management coaches. Besides Lee, other blog contributors include Deborah Arvin in Plano, along with George Hendley, and Carl Youngberg of Richardson. Each week, one of these consultants will post something related to productivity issues and encourage comments and additional tips from readers. The blog will contain information on team-building, career planning, problem solving, customer service, time management, and much more.
